Things Fall Apart is a novel by Chinua Achebe, published in 1958 in the United Kingdom.
The work recounts the story of Okonkwo, a man from the Igbo tribe (southeastern Nigeria), whose village disintegrates under British influence. Okonkwo is a young man whose father left no inheritance, leading him to have to ask for seedings necessary to begin his career as a farmer.
